Default miss off the line?

My car was running fine when a code 41 showed up(cam sensor) a few weeks ago. I did not seem to affect the performance or drivability at first but the last few days my car suffers from a hesitation or miss right at launch. Can a cam sensor cause something like this or is there something else wrong? Full tune-up has been done recently.
